#1a179c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1a179c is composed of 10.2% red, 9%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.3% cyan, 85.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 241.4 degrees, a saturation of 74.3% and a lightness of 35.1%. #1a179c color hex could be obtained by blending #342eff with #000039.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#1a179c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1a179c has RGB values of R:26, G:23,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 1709980.

Shades and Tints of #1a179c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#f0f0f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1a179c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#55555e is the less saturated color, while #0602b1 is the most saturated one.
